Closure of a Beloved New Zealand Cafe
In 2023, Peter Jackson acquired the historic Submarine Barracks property on the Wellington peninsula, alongside his partner Fran Walsh. They had expressed intentions to restore its natural beauty.
The Chocolate Fish Cafe, which has been a staple at this historic site, announced they would close following news of their lease being terminated in January, calling it a “devastating blow”.
Through a heartfelt social media statement, the cafe owners pleaded for a chance to converse with Jackson and Fran, expressing their desire to remain open: “We don’t want to be forced to close. We don’t want to be shut down.”
Nevertheless, WingNut PM, the property arm of Peter Jackson and Fran Walsh’s WingNut Group, indicated that discussions regarding occupancy had been ongoing since 2024.
A Glimpse into Peter Jackson’s Filmmaking Legacy
Peter Jackson embarked on his filmmaking journey with the 1987 slapstick comedy, Bad Taste. His major breakthrough came with Heavenly Creatures in 1995, which earned him an Oscar nomination. He later directed the Lord of the Rings trilogy (2001-2003), which grossed nearly $3 billion globally and won 17 Oscars. Following that, he adapted King Kong and returned to J.R.R. Tolkien’s world with The Hobbit trilogy (2012-2014), which also saw over $2.9 billion in box office success.
